About this Exam

The Missouri Educator Gateway Assessments (MEGA) School Counselor (510) exam is a required criterion-referenced test for individuals aiming to become certified school counselors within the state of Missouri. This examination is designed to assess whether a candidate possesses the requisite knowledge and skills to effectively serve in a PK–12 school setting. It is typically taken after the completion of an approved educator preparation program, which usually includes a master's degree in school counseling. This certification is crucial for those dedicated to supporting students' academic, social/emotional, and career development in a professional educational environment.

What the Course Entails and Exam Details

This examination is not a course itself, but a culmination of the knowledge acquired during a school counseling preparation program. The MEGA School Counselor test is built around several key content domains that reflect the essential roles and responsibilities of a school counselor. While specific weighting can vary, the core topics generally include:

  • Knowledge of Learners: Understanding child and adolescent development, learning theories, and factors that influence student well-being.
  • The Comprehensive School Counseling Program: Designing, implementing, and evaluating a comprehensive program that addresses academic, career, and social/emotional needs, including curriculum development and individual student planning.
  • The Professional School Counselor: Ethical and legal standards, professional roles and responsibilities, advocacy, and collaboration with stakeholders.
  • Academic Development: Strategies to promote academic success, equity, and access for all students.
  • Career Development: Assisting students with career exploration, planning, and postsecondary transitions.
  • Social/Emotional Development: Providing responsive services, including individual and group counseling, crisis intervention, and referrals.
  • Professional Practice: Using data, technology, and consultation skills to improve student outcomes and program effectiveness.

 

 

What to Expect in the Final Exam

The MEGA School Counselor exam is a computer-based test. Understanding its format can help reduce anxiety on test day.

  • Exam Format: The test consists of approximately 100 multiple-choice questions. Each question requires you to select the best answer from four options.
  • Passing Score Requirements: Passing scores for MEGA assessments are established by the Missouri State Board of Education. Candidates receive a scaled score, and a passing score is generally a scaled score of 220 or higher. Your score report will indicate whether you passed or did not pass.
  • Time Limits: Candidates are given a total of 2 hours for the actual test. There is also a 15-minute tutorial and a nondisclosure agreement, making the total appointment time 2 hours and 15 minutes.
  • Specific Rules: On test day, you must present valid, government-issued photo identification. Personal items, including cell phones, are not permitted in the testing room. Pearson VUE, the test administrator, provides specific guidelines and a tutorial to help you understand the testing interface. It is important to read and follow all test center rules.

 

 

 How to Study and Exam Centers

Effective preparation is key to success on the MEGA School Counselor exam. Here are actionable study strategies and information on where to take the test:

How to Study:

  • Review the Official Test Framework: This is your primary study guide. Download it from the official MEGA website. It outlines all the competencies and descriptive statements on which the test questions are based.
  • Use Practice Tests: Taking full-length practice tests under timed conditions is essential. This helps you become familiar with the types of questions and manage your time effectively. Use your results to identify areas where you need further study.
  • Create a Study Schedule: Allocate regular, dedicated study time to each content domain. Break down your study sessions into manageable topics.
  • Utilize Study Guides and Resources: Look for study guides specifically for the MEGA School Counselor (510) exam. Many candidates also benefit from reviewing textbooks and course materials from their preparation programs.
  • Focus on Ethical Guidelines: Pay close attention to the American School Counselor Association (ASCA) Ethical Standards for School Counselors, as these are heavily emphasized in the exam.
  • Form a Study Group: Collaborating with peers can provide different perspectives and help clarify difficult concepts.

Exam Centers:

  • Online Portals and Registration: Registration and scheduling are managed through the official MEGA website, which is supported by Pearson.
  • Test Administration: The MEGA exams are administered by Pearson VUE. You can select a test date and location from available Pearson Professional Centers and other authorized testing locations.
  • Testing Centers: There are many authorized Pearson VUE testing centers located throughout Missouri and in neighboring states. During registration, you will be able to search for centers nearest to you and view their available appointments.
